Abstract

Sweat out the fat with TSLP! Thymic stromal lymphopoietin (TSLP) is a cytokine that can promote immune responses that characterize allergic diseases. Choa et al . found that mice engineered to produce elevated TSLP displayed selective white adipose tissue loss that protected them from obesity, insulin resistance, and steatohepatitis (see the Perspective by Schneider). Protection was not mediated by eosinophils, regulatory T cells, or innate lymphoid cells. Rather, TLSP induced the migration of conventional T cells to sebaceous glands in the skin. Once there, these T cells promoted white adipose tissue loss by the hypersecretion of sebum, a lipid-rich substance that augments the skin’s barrier function. This mechanism, which likely evolved to enhance cutaneous antimicrobial defenses, could be possibly targeted in future treatments for obesity. —STS
